Peaks Steer Brook Gorge, Hidden Cave, Woodbury Outlook, Great Hill (Bow), NH
Trails
Trails: Hamilton's Path, Nancy's Trail, Upper Black Gum Trail, Hidden Cave Trail, Woodbury Outlook Loop, Glacial Erratic Trail, snowmobile trail, Great Hill Loop, Walter's Way, bushwhacks

Date of Hike: Saturday, March 21, 2020
Parking/Access Road Notes
Parking/Access Road Notes: At the trailhead for Nottingcook Forest on South Bow Rd. in Bow. 
Surface Conditions
Surface Conditions: Dry Trail, Mud - Minor/Avoidable

Comments: Hiking local ... Since we knew the direct route to Great Hill would be crowded (and it was), we quickly left Hamilton's Path and bushwhacked over to Nancy's Trail, and then saw no one for the rest of the hike. We just kind of made up a route as we went, mixing in a few bushwhacks here and there to make things more direct, visiting some the great features this wonderful forest has to offer. By the time we arrived back at Great Hill, everyone had gone home.

Trails here are mainly dry with just some minor mud in spots. It was a recuperative day for both the mind and body amidst the general uncertainty in the world right now.
